DIY Alternator Replacement: Stay Charged Without a Shop Visit

Why the Job Matters

A dead alternator strands you without warning. That whining under the hood dims headlights, kills the radio, and finally shuts the engine off. Replacing the unit yourself saves $200-$400 in labor, teaches you the heart of the charging system, and—done right—takes less than an hour in most front-wheel-drive cars.

Know the Warning Signs

  • Dashboard battery light stays on after start-up
  • Headlights brighten with revs, then fade at idle
  • Slow window motors or seat motors
  • Sweet-sour smell of overheated alternator windings
  • Whining or grinding noise from the drive belt area that rises with engine speed

These clues point to a weak alternator, not a bad battery. Test first: with the engine running, a healthy alternator should push 13.8-14.4 volts at the battery posts. If the reading crawls below 12.6 volts, replacement is next.

Tools & Supplies Checklist

  • New or remanufactured alternator (match part number to VIN)
  • 3/8" drive ratchet plus long extension
  • Metric socket set 8-18 mm (most imports) or SAE (older domestics)
  • Serpentine-belt tool or breaker bar for tensioner
  • Digital multimeter for final voltage check
  • Safety glasses and mechanic gloves
  • Zip ties or bungee to hold the belt away
  • Dielectric grease for terminals
  • Penetrating oil for stubborn fasteners

No specialty pullers or scanners needed—just solid hand tools and patience.

Before You Start: Safety Rules

  1. Shut the engine off, remove ignition key, set parking brake.
  2. Disconnect the negative battery cable; tuck it clear of the post.
  3. Wait five minutes for any residual voltage to bleed off control modules.
  4. Never wedge hands near the cooling fan; it can spin even with the key off.
  5. Keep rings and watches away from hot surfaces and spinning pulleys.

Step-by-Step Alternator Removal

1. Access

Pop the hood and photograph the belt routing. Modern serpentine belts snake through six or more pulleys; one picture prevents a head-scratching puzzle later. On tight transverse engines you may need to remove the plastic splash guard or the air-intake snorkel. Four push pins or 10 mm bolts usually free these parts.

2. Belt Slack

Fit the serpentine tool or breaker bar into the square hole on the spring-loaded tensioner. Rotate clockwise (GM, Ford, most Asian) or counter-clockwise (many Chrysler) until the belt loosens. Slide the belt off the alternator pulley only—leave it routed everywhere else. Secure it with a zip tie so it cannot slip off idlers.

3. Electrical Disconnects

Alternators have two circuits: high-amperage B+ feed and low-voltage sense/regulator plug. First, tug the plastic locking tab on the regulator plug and separate it. Then remove the rubber boot on the B+ stud. Use a 10 mm or 12 mm socket to spin off the nut. Cup your fingers under the ring terminal so it cannot drop into the abyss. Slide the terminal out, inspect for green corrosion, and seal the stud temporarily with tape to avoid accidental grounding.

4. Mounting Bolts

Most alternators hang on two bolts: a long pivot bolt at the bottom and a shorter slider or lock bolt on top. Break each bolt loose with a breaker bar, then spin them out by hand. Note any spacers or sleeves trapped between the housing and bracket—they must return to the exact position. The alternator will now swing free; cradle it against your forearm and wiggle it clear of the bracket. Aluminum units are light (6-8 lb), yet awkward in narrow bays.

5. Comparison Check

Lay old and new units side by side on the bench. Pulley diameter, clocking of the ear holes, and regulator plug shape must match exactly. Spin the pulley by hand—a slight magnetic cogging is normal. If the replacement came with a new pulley, transfer the old one if your belt set-up uses a different groove count.

Installation: The Reverse Dance

  1. Sneak the new alternator into the bracket. Align the lower ear first; the long pivot bolt should slide finger-tight.
  2. Install the upper bolt plus any spacers. Snug both bolts but do not torque yet—leave ¼-inch play so the unit can float for belt alignment.
  3. Reconnect the B+ cable. Hand-start the nut to avoid cross-threading soft aluminum, then torque to factory spec—usually 85-105 in-lb. Slide the rubber boot fully home.
  4. Plug in the regulator connector until the latch clicks. A dab of dielectric grease keeps moisture out.
  5. Reinstall the belt. Use the serpentine tool to lever the tensioner, slip the belt over the alternator pulley last, then slowly release the tensioner so the belt seats in every groove.
  6. Double-check routing against your photo. A single misaligned rib creates squeal and premature wear.
  7. Torque the mounting bolts to spec: 35-40 ft-lb for the long bolt, 20-25 ft-lb for the slider in most Hondas/Toyotas—consult the service manual if you own a torque wrench, otherwise good and tight with a standard ratchet works.

First Fire-Up and Voltage Test

Reconnect the negative battery terminal. Crank the engine and idle for 30 seconds. No sparks, no squeals? Good. Set your multimeter to DC volts, probes on battery posts. You should now read 14.0-14.5 volts at warm idle. Turn on high beams, HVAC fan on max, and rear defroster; voltage should stay above 13.5 volts. If it dives below battery resting voltage (12.6 V), stop and inspect connections. Rev to 2,000 rpm—voltage should be steady, not surge. The battery light on the dash must extinguish within three seconds. If it glows, the new unit is defective or the sense wire is loose.

Clearing the Computer

Some vehicles log low-voltage or alternator codes. A $20 OBD-II scanner can erase them. Simply plug in, press "clear," and drive five miles so the ECU relearns charging parameters. No scanner? Disconnect the battery for fifteen minutes; the radio presets will reset but codes vanish.

Tips for Stubborn Situations

  • Rusted B+ nut: Soak with PB Blaster, hold the stud rigid with a Torx bit in its end so you do not twist the internal diode plate.
  • Drop-in style alternators (many newer GM trucks) require no bracket removal—lift the intake cover, pop three bolts, swap, done.
  • Transverse V-6 with alternator buried under the intake: remove the cooling-fan shroud for an extra four inches of knuckle room.
  • Keep the old unit; parts stores refund a "core" credit of $20-$60 when you bring it back. Rebuild shops strip diodes and regulators for resale.

What Not to Do

  • Do not hammer the pulley to seat it—use a proper installer or the bearing will crumble within weeks.
  • Do not overtighten the B+ nut; aluminum threads strip easily, turning a simple fix into a new alternator housing.
  • Do not rely solely on belt tensioner spring pressure. Once installed, tug the longest belt span—½-inch deflection is ideal. Too loose causes squeal; too tight murders water-pump bearings.

How Long Will the New One Last?

Remanufactured alternators typically carry a three-year warranty and can cruise past 100,000 miles if the rest of the system is healthy. Keep the battery terminals clean, replace weak batteries promptly (a sulfated cell forces the alternator to overwork), and spray the housing with electrical cleaner every oil change to prevent brush dust buildup.

Environmental Disposal

Old alternators contain copper windings, aluminum housings, and diodes with trace heavy metals. Most chain parts stores accept them free for recycling. Scrap yards pay by the pound for clean aluminum. Never trash the unit; 95% of its material is reusable according to the U.S. Environmental Protection Agency.
